Savage Deviljho: The Apex Predator's Fury Unleashed
The Savage Deviljho represents an even more ferocious and aggressive iteration of the already formidable Deviljho. This colossal pickle-shaped brute wyvern is a force of nature, driven by an insatiable hunger and an unparalleled capacity for destruction. Encountering a Savage Deviljho is a true test of a hunter's skill and resilience.
Savage Deviljho primarily appears in the Guiding Lands, often as an invader or during specific investigations. It can also be encountered in certain high-rank quests and events. Its presence is usually saled by its distinctive, guttural roars and the sheer devastation it leaves in its wake. Be prepared for an intense battle when this monster enters the arena.
Combat Strategy
The Savage Deviljho's attacks are characterized by their immense power and speed. It wields its massive jaws with devastating effect, capable of inflicting massive damage with bites, lunges, and tail sweeps. Its sature move is its Dragon Breath, a concentrated beam of dragon energy that can melt hunters. This attack is telegraphed by its head glowing with draconic energy, so be ready to dodge.
When enraged, the Savage Deviljho's chest will glow, and it will gain access to even more devastating attacks, including a powerful charge that can cover significant distances. Its weakness lies in its head and chest when not enraged. However, its sheer aggression makes targeting these areas challenging. Breaking its tail can be a priority, as it can limit its reach. The Savage Deviljho is particularly vulnerable to Dragon element damage. While it has a moderate resistance to most other elements, Dragon is its Achilles' heel. Its raw attack power is immense, making defensive skills and careful positioning crucial.
Recommended Gear and Items
- Armor: Prioritize armor with high defense and skills that boost your offensive capabilities. Health Boost is almost mandatory for surviving its onslaught. Skills like Attack Boost, Weakness Exploit, and Critical Eye will significantly increase your damage output. For blademasters, Guard and Guard Up can be invaluable if you plan to block its attacks.
- Weapons: Dragon element weapons are your top choice. If you don't have a strong Dragon weapon, focus on weapons with high raw damage and good sharpness. Consider weapons that can inflict Stun or Paralysis, as these status effects can create brief openings.
- Items: Bring Nulberries to cure Dragonblight, which it can inflict. Adamant Seeds can boost your defense, and Demondrugs for attack. Flash Pods can be used to interrupt some of its attacks, but be cautious as it can quickly recover. Health Potions and Mega Potions are, as always, essential.
